Note: This bug is displayed in read-only format because the product is no longer active in Red Hat Bugzilla.

Bug 1230854

Summary: Undo moving swimlane messes up BP diagram
Product: [Retired] JBoss BPMS Platform 6 Reporter: Jeremy Lindop <jlindop>
Component: jBPM DesignerAssignee: Tihomir Surdilovic <tsurdilo>
Status: CLOSED EOL QA Contact: Jozef Marko <jomarko>
Severity: high Docs Contact:
Priority: high    
Version: 6.1.0CC: ghu, hfuruich, mbaluch
Target Milestone: DR1   
Target Release: 6.2.0   
Hardware: Unspecified   
OS: All   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
: 1233437 (view as bug list) Environment:
Last Closed: 2020-03-27 20:06:51 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 1233437    
Attachments:
Description Flags
Large BP for testing
none
Video of problem none

Description Jeremy Lindop 2015-06-11 15:51:06 UTC
Created attachment 1037753 [details]
Large BP for testing

Description of problem:
The "undo" button doesn't work after moving a swimlane. It doesn't undo the previous action. Instead, it messes up the process flow. See the attached BP and video.

Version-Release number of selected component (if applicable):
bpmsuite-6.1.0.GA

Steps to Reproduce:
1. Open the attached BP
2. move the orange box at the bottom then click the 'Undo' button
3. The diagram is messed up

Comment 1 Jeremy Lindop 2015-06-11 15:53:46 UTC
Created attachment 1037754 [details]
Video of problem

Comment 3 Tihomir Surdilovic 2015-06-24 11:55:34 UTC
The core problem is fixed by https://bugzilla.redhat.com/show_bug.cgi?id=1232975.

There seems to be an issue with text annotations however which we need to keep looking at.

Comment 4 Tihomir Surdilovic 2015-06-24 12:12:41 UTC
the text annotation issue cannot be reproduced if the annotations have been placed inside the lane correctly tobegin with. seems fixed by https://bugzilla.redhat.com/show_bug.cgi?id=1232975

Comment 5 Tihomir Surdilovic 2015-06-24 14:35:24 UTC
This BZ is fixed via BZ 1232975. Disabling automatic connection layout fixes the problem with rearrangement of sequence flows after undo operations

Comment 6 Tihomir Surdilovic 2015-06-24 14:40:33 UTC
We have created BZ https://bugzilla.redhat.com/show_bug.cgi?id=1235330 for the text annotation issue. It is indirectly related to this one because the test BP contains swimlanes with text annotations included. 
We will fix https://bugzilla.redhat.com/show_bug.cgi?id=1235330 at a later stage

Comment 7 Jozef Marko 2015-10-05 12:01:34 UTC
Verified on 6.2.0.ER3.
Connectors are not rerouted automatically after undo button is used. 

But please see the new linked bugzilla, where I filed problem with docker on edges.